The Environmental Cost of Traditional Web Hosting
Web hosting involves the storage and management of websites on servers housed in data centers. These servers are powered 24/7 to ensure constant availability. With millions of websites online, data centers now account for roughly 1-2% of global electricity consumption, according to the International Energy Agency (IEA). This number is expected to grow as internet usage continues to climb.
Cooling systems alone can consume nearly half of a data center’s power. While many companies are adopting energy-efficient practices, such as using renewable energy or optimizing server usage, the sheer volume of data being processed and stored continues to push infrastructure to its limits.

Challenges Ahead
Despite its promise, quantum computing is still in its infancy. Several technical and practical hurdles must be overcome before it can be integrated into commercial hosting infrastructure:
- Stability: Qubits are notoriously unstable and require extremely controlled environments.
- Cost: Quantum computers are currently expensive to build and maintain.
- Scalability: Building quantum systems that can handle web hosting workloads on a global scale remains a future goal.
However, companies that begin preparing now will be better positioned to lead when the technology becomes viable. Partnerships with quantum startups, investments in quantum algorithm research, and exploration of hybrid (classical-quantum) models are all strategic steps forward.
